Special Olympics Illinois summer games are lifechanging

Each year, more than 22,000 athletes from across Illinois converge on Bloomington-Normal to compete in the Special Olympics Illinois summer games. This annual event showcases not only athletic talent but also the lifechanging power of community and determination.

The Scope of the Event

The Special Olympics Illinois summer games draw over 22,000 athletes each year. Held in Bloomington-Normal, the event shines a spotlight on the unwavering spirit and talent of participants from every corner of the state.
